> Seeing as KatG haven't put up a creative commons license,
> anyone can take their shit and do what they like with it. You have this completely the wrong way around. Anything without an explicit license is fully protected by copyright law. Creative Commons licenses are ways to give up some of the powers all works get from copyright law to allow users to copy it around themselves under various restrictions depending on the license version. However the rest I agree with -- nothing stops Curry mentioning your site just like nothing stops Google serving ads with their results. But it's probably better to have people coming over from there even if they're a bit confused by the site layout than to not be mentioned, I should think.
